# `PtcRunner.Lisp.Runtime.Describe`
[🔗](https://github.com/andreasronge/ptc_runner/blob/main/lib/ptc_runner/lisp/runtime/describe.ex#L1)

Bounded data-shape summaries for PTC-Lisp values.

# `opts`

```elixir
@type opts() :: %{depth: pos_integer(), paths: boolean(), sample: pos_integer()}
```

# `describe`

```elixir
@spec describe(term()) :: map()
```

# `describe`

```elixir
@spec describe(term(), term()) :: map()
```

---

*Consult [api-reference.md](api-reference.md) for complete listing*
